7/02/25 Cubs' Shota Imanaga aims to shut down struggling Guardians. Shota Imanaga returned from injury last week and immediately regained his star form on the mound for the Chicago Cubs. Imanaga, however, hopes to be better than his only other career appearance against Cleveland when the host Cubs try to hand the Guardians a sixth consecutive loss on Wednesday night. After missing seven weeks with a strained left hamstring, Imanaga (4-2, 2.54 ERA) allowed one hit, a walk and struck out three over five innings during Chicago's 3-0 victory at St. Louis on Thursday.

6/29/25 Chicago Cubs, Pittsburgh Pirates in 'Serious Trade Talks' on Mitch Keller. The Chicago Cubs may not be wasting time trying to find another starting pitcher to go along with Shota Imanaga. USA Today's Bob Nightengale reported on Sunday that the Cubs and the Pittsburgh Pirates were engaged in “serious trade talks” about pitcher Mitch Keller. Earlier this week, The Athletic's Ken Rosenthal wrote that Keller could be available at the trade deadline, even though he signed a five-year extension with the Pirates last year.

6/27/25 Cubs Reportedly Targeting Two Pirates Pitchers in Potential Blockbuster Trade. The Chicago Cubs should be back on track in terms of the pitching staff after getting back over the last week both ace Shota Imanaga and star reliever Porter Hodge. While things should stabilize, this is a Cubs pitching staff that has been thin all season long even before injuries became a factor. Chicago is expected to be one of the most aggressive teams in baseball when the trade deadline rolls around and Jed Hoyer has been fairly open about the fact that they want to add pitching both in the rotation and in the bullpen. A report this week indicates they could be trying to kill two birds with one stone in what would be a huge blockbuster trade with a divisional rival.
